The Latitude 64 Raketen (Swedish for “rocket”) is a high-speed understable distance driver designed to deliver maximum distance with minimal effort—especially for players without pro-level arm speed. Sporting flight numbers of 15 | 4 | -2 | 3, the Raketen is engineered for long, controllable s-turns and tailwind bombs. Its significant high-speed turn (-2) paired with a reliable fade (3) makes it a go-to option for distance shots that require both glide and forgiveness.
Approved on June 10, 2015, the Raketen shares the wide-rimmed, aerodynamic DNA of the Missilen, including Latitude 64’s unique hexagonal surface texture, which was intended to reduce drag and increase speed. With a 2.4 cm rim thickness, a 1.7 cm height, and a 21.1 cm diameter, the disc sits firmly in the hand and is built for power drives. The Raketen’s flexibility rating of 10.21 kg and shallow 1.1 cm rim depth offer a fast, snappy release ideal for players looking to add distance without sacrificing control. Though no longer in production, the Raketen is remembered for its innovative design and user-friendly flight characteristics.
